#756084 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#756084 is composed of 45.9% red, 37.6%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.4% cyan, 27.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 275 degrees, a saturation of 15.8% and a lightness of 44.7%. #756084 color hex could be obtained by blending #eac0ff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#756084 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#756084 has RGB values of R:117, G:96,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 7692420.
| Hex triplet | 756084 | #756084 |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 117, 96, 132 | rgb(117,96,132) |
| RGB Percent | 45.9, 37.6, 51.8 | rgb(45.9%,37.6%,51.8%) |
| CMYK | 11, 27, 0, 48 | |
| HSL | 275°, 15.8, 44.7 | hsl(275,15.8%,44.7%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 275°, 27.3, 51.8 | |
| Web Safe | 666699 | #666699 |
| CIE-LAB | 43.965, 15.775, -16.867 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 15.683, 13.814, 23.669 |
| xyY | 0.295, 0.26, 13.814 |
| CIE-LCH | 43.965, 23.094, 313.083 |
| CIE-LUV | 43.965, 8.923, -25.9 |
| Hunter-Lab | 37.167, 10.279, -11.74 |
| Binary | 01110101, 01100000, 10000100 |

Shades and Tints of #756084
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060507 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#756084
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727272 is the less saturated color, while #8408dc is the most saturated one.
